United States Second Circuit
SILVERMAN v. TRACAR, S.A., 00-5072
In a Chapter 11 reorganization proceeding, a creditor who fails to appeal a post-confirmation order appointing a trustee is precluded from challenging the trustee's appointment when the trustee subsequently obtains an order affecting the creditor's interests.
